Job Overview

The Employment Specialist role involves providing tailored support to individuals with mental health conditions, helping them secure and maintain meaningful employment through the Individual Placement and Support (IPS) model. Key responsibilities include assessing clients' skills and aspirations, developing action plans, sourcing job opportunities, and collaborating with employers to facilitate job placements. The position requires strong interpersonal skills, empathy, and the ability to work within a multidisciplinary team to promote recovery through employment. Employment Specialists are expected to manage a caseload of clients, offering ongoing support to ensure successful job retention and integration into the workforce.


You Will Be Required To

  • Proactively manage a caseload of people, who have experienced Mental Health Difficulties, to either find and maintain paid employment, or to retain existing employment.
  • Follow the IPS model, collate evidence and participate in Fidelity Reviews.
  • Identify and meet the employment goals of clients by providing individually tailored programmes, using a person-centred approach.
  • Work within a multi-disciplinary environment and liaise closely with a variety of stakeholders i.e. Department of Work and Pensions (DWP) and Citizen Advice.
  • Work proactively at Employer Engagement and research the labour market and spend time getting to know local employers, in order to negotiate job opportunities.
  • Support Service Users and employers to identify reasonable adjustments and return to work strategies, to ensure job retention.
